Output 43f0c6e999e126fa971ed619243a593717ca1fb94d954a1de6d10865374a0037:2

value
70340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49ea2f7784339c7e37de09823ddfa17927c11ab9 OP_EQUAL
address
38Rqo31TZ8M3eYyNeKdsDaB8RupAC4LTWk
transaction
43f0c6e999e126fa971ed619243a593717ca1fb94d954a1de6d10865374a0037
spent
true